Binary packages built by this source
- kde-config-screenlocker: KCM Module for kscreenlocker
KDE systemsettings module to configure kscreenlocker.
.
kscreenlocker can be configured to support the PAM ("Pluggable Authentication
Modules") system for password checking (for unlocking the display).
.
PAM is a flexible application-transparent configurable user-authentication
system found on FreeBSD, Solaris, and Linux (and maybe other unixes).
.
Information about PAM may be found on its homepage
http://www.kernel. org/pub/ linux/libs/ pam/
(Despite the location, this information is NOT Linux-specific.)
.
This package contains the KCM settings module for kscreenlocker.
